[Address] Ergonian aggression
Honorable delegates,
the State of Talenore has received a threat from the rogue nation called Ergonia.
Without any proof, they even admit to acting solely on rumors, Talenorian vessels are being tracked in international waters.
The government of Talenore hereby informs the rogue nation of Ergonia that any action by Ergonia against any private or public asset of the State of Talenore shall be considered an act of war and will be met with lethal force.
The State of Talenore calls upon the international community to isolate this rogue nation. All assets and citizens of Ergonia are hereby banned from Talenorian soil. Any citizens of Ergonia currently visiting or residing in Talenore are offered asylum.
I yield the floor.

I advise members of the following applicable provisions of the General Membership Treaty:
I advise members of the following applicable provisions of the General Membership Treaty:
Debate continues.5. The General Assembly has the authority to appoint mediators and arbitrators at the request of any member nation.
5.a. Nations that use MTO mediation agree to follow the findings of the mediator.
6. Any party to this treaty may put before the General Assembly a Resolution for an MTO Mission.
6.a. Valid missions are providing aid to any nation in need, peacekeeping services in zones of conflict or potential conflict or any action deemed absolutely necessary by the General Assembly to the peace and well-being of Micras.
6.b. For a Resolution for an MTO Mission to pass, the General Assembly must meet a 3/4th (75.0%) vote in favor of the resolution.
6.c. MTO Missions are non-binding and no member of the MTO is obligated to take part in them.
7. Any party to this treaty may put before the General Assembly a Resolution for an MTO Opinion.
7.a. An MTO opinion will be a non-binding opinion on the issue(s) provided in the resolution.
7.b. An MTO Opinion resolution will only become an official MTO Opinion upon a unanimous vote in favor of said resolution.
